Abstract
The present study was carried out at Department of Vegetable Science, Punjab Agricultural University, Ludhiana during 2010 to 2012. The experimental material consisted of 39 F1s of garden pea (obtained through line x tester method by using 13 lines and 3 testers), 13 lines, 3 testers and 2 checks viz. Arkel and MA-6 were grown in November 2011. Highly significant GCA and SCA variance observed for most of the characters studied indicated the importance of both additive and non-additive gene expression of these characters. The estimates of component of genetic variance indicated predominance role of non-additive gene action in the expression of most of characters. Among the lines, 09/PMVAR-7, PB.89 and NS-3 were found to be the best general combiners for days taken to flowering and days taken to maturity. 09/PMVAR-4 and NS-3 for number of seeds per pod, number of pods per node, 100-seed weight, number of pods per plant and green pod yield per plant. Among the testers, PM-65 was good combiner for most of the characters studied. The cross combination Arka Sampoorna x 08/PMVAR-4 was good specific combiner for days to marketable maturity, pod length, pod weight, number of seeds per pod, number of pods per node, number of pods per plant, green pod yield per plant, plant height, crude protein and soluble protein content while the crosses namely, Arka Karthik x PM-65 and PB.89 x PM-65 showed maximum heterosis over better parent and standard checks for most of the traits studied. The cross combinations showing good SCA effects and heterosis can be used in future breeding programmes.
